Why are the negative numbers included?

When you multiply two negative numbers together, you get a positive number. That means both the positive and negative numbers are factors of 438,185.

Example:
1 x 438,185 = 438,185
and
-1 x -438,185 = 438,185
Notice both answers equal 438,185
